Hiking around Arpheuilles offers a network of trails through the rural landscape of the Indre department. The region is characterized by gentle elevations, numerous ponds, and areas of woodland. These features provide varied terrain for outdoor activities, with routes often circling natural water bodies or passing through agricultural land.

Perched on a rocky spur stands this feudal castle. Its imposing silhouette dominates this strategic stronghold and overlooks the surrounding area. The castle dates from the 11th century and overlooks the Roman road from Poitiers to Orléans.

The Church of Saint-Genou is a perfect example of Romanesque architecture in the region. Note during the visit, the beautifully carved architectural sculptures inside and outside.

Saint-Genou Abbey was built in the 12th century and has been listed as a historical monument since 1862.

There are over 25 hiking trails around Arpheuilles, offering a variety of options for different skill levels and preferences. The region's network of paths allows for exploration of its rural landscape, ponds, and woodlands.
Yes, Arpheuilles offers several easy hikes perfect for beginners or families. For example, the Hiking loop from Le Bois Garnier is an easy 2.3-mile (3.7 km) trail that takes about 55 minutes to complete, leading through pleasant woodland.
For those seeking longer walks, Arpheuilles has moderate trails that extend further into the landscape. The From the old abbey of Saint-Genou to the castles of Palluau-sur-Indre route is a moderate 7.7-mile (12.3 km) trail, connecting historical sites with the natural environment. Another option is the Baron Pond loop from Sainte-Gemme, which is 14 km long.
While Arpheuilles is known for its gentle elevations, there is one trail classified as difficult among the 27 available routes. Most trails are easy to moderate, focusing on enjoyable walks through the rural landscape rather than strenuous climbs.
The hiking trails in Arpheuilles are highly rated by the komoot community, with an average score of 4.6 stars from over 40 reviews. Hikers often praise the tranquil pond circuits, gentle forest paths, and routes connecting charming rural villages, highlighting the peaceful and varied terrain.
Yes, many of the trails around Arpheuilles are circular, allowing you to start and end at the same point. Examples include the Étang Vieux – L'Étang de la Loge loop from Saulnay and the Baron Pond loop from Étang Baron, both offering scenic circuits around local water bodies.
The trails often feature the region's characteristic ponds and woodlands. Notable attractions nearby include Bellebouche Pond, which also has a beach and a picnic site. The route "From the old abbey of Saint-Genou to the castles of Palluau-sur-Indre" connects to historical sites like Palluau-sur-Indre.
Arpheuilles's landscape of gentle elevations and woodlands can be appealing for winter walks, especially on clear days. However, conditions can vary, so it's always advisable to check local weather forecasts and trail conditions before heading out, as some paths might be muddy or slippery.
The best time to hike in Arpheuilles is generally from spring to autumn (April to October), when the weather is mild and the natural scenery is vibrant. Spring brings blooming flora, while autumn offers beautiful foliage around the ponds and forests. Summer is also pleasant, though it can be warmer.
Many trails in rural areas like Arpheuilles are generally dog-friendly, especially those passing through woodlands and open countryside. However, it's always recommended to keep dogs on a leash, particularly when passing through agricultural land or near livestock, and to respect local regulations and private property.
Public transport options directly to trailheads in Arpheuilles may be limited due to its rural location. It is often more convenient to access the trails by car, with parking typically available in villages or designated areas near popular starting points. We recommend checking local transport schedules if relying on public transit.
While Arpheuilles is characterized by gentle elevations rather than dramatic peaks, many trails offer scenic views of the tranquil ponds and the surrounding rural landscape. Routes that circle water bodies, such as the Étang Vieux – L'Étang de la Loge loop, provide picturesque vistas across the water and its natural surroundings.
